Requirements
Complete the portfolio.
Elements of Portfolio
The student is responsible for the development of a CGE portfolio that includes the following elements in the following order.
Project PICOT question
Abstract summary of project topic (approximately 500 words)
Literature review (may be copied and pasted from the Week 3 assignment with revisions as necessary)
Reflection on Course Outcome (CO) achievement
List each CO as a heading in proper APA format.
For each CO, provide a reflective summary of how you feel you have progressed in meeting this outcome through the resources and activities of NR631.
Scholarly application sections of the following (in order) project management tools (may be copied and pasted from those assignments with revisions as necessary)
Project Charter (Week 2)
Project Scope (Week 2)
Communication Plan (Week 4)
Deliverables and CSF (Week 5)
Work Breakdown Structure (Week 6)
Gantt Chart (Week 6)
RACI (Week 7)
Risk Register (Week 7)
The following documents included as separate appendices in the following order
Learning Agreement
Signed (verified) by both student and mentor
Reflective summary of progress through the end of CGE I of progress toward that goal
Signed CGE activity log with a minimum of 72 hours
